LEGS, arms and necks are too precious to be subjected to the risks of mechanical noviees. In the reckless efforts of many makers to produce light bicycles, the margin of safety has been reduced to the danger point. Only the most thorough testing of each piece by scientific methods is a guarantee uocn which an innocent public may rely. Our greatest essential is the use of crucible steel, a material very expensive to obtain and far more expansive to work. In Victor bicycles, all balls, cones, rear spooket and hub, brake levers, cranks and many other parts are made of crucible steel. We believe the Victor rear hub is the only bicycle hub in existence made oc cruj>K|o steel. These parts iir» '.vrudened in oil, giving theia ay even hardness throughout.
